Streaming Defenses: Finding Value on the Waiver Wire

Sometimes, the best strategy is to be flexible. This is where streaming defenses come in. Streaming is about picking up a defense each week based on the matchup. This approach can be very effective, especially if you have a strong understanding of which teams to target. Each week, you can find solid options on the waiver wire. Look for defenses facing struggling offenses, rookie quarterbacks, or teams with offensive line issues. Look at the Washington Commanders. They might be available on the waiver wire. If they have a favorable matchup, then you should consider streaming them. Next, look at the Tennessee Titans. They can be a solid streaming option, depending on the opponent. Matchup is key. Another good option could be the Green Bay Packers. Their performance is highly dependent on the opposing team. This strategy requires some research each week, but it can pay off big time. Important Factors for Defense Ranking

Now, let's talk about the key things that go into defense rankings. When assessing a defense, look at their ability to generate sacks, force turnovers, and stop the run. These factors are crucial for their fantasy output. For generating sacks, pay attention to their pass rush. A strong pass rush leads to more sacks and pressures, which can disrupt the opposing quarterback and force mistakes. When analyzing turnovers, focus on their interception rate and fumble recoveries. These plays are game-changers and can result in significant fantasy points. For stopping the run, see how well they hold up against the run. A strong run defense prevents the opposing team from controlling the clock and moving the chains. To truly evaluate a defense, you need to go beyond the raw stats. Consider the coaching schemes, player personnel, and any injuries that might affect their performance. Look at the team's defensive coordinator and the impact of his strategies. Evaluate the players that make up the defense. Injuries can significantly impact a defense's performance.
